The adorably malicious A Life Less Ordinary is director Danny Boyle's version of a romantic fantasy comedy.
There's guns, headshots, car wrecks, musical numbers, animation, robots, angels and bank robberies, in short, everything that makes a good rom-com. Unfortunately after you're done taking this fun ride of a road trip you can't help but feel there never really was any point to it all. No matter it's really just good fun without a lingering aftertaste or really nary an afterthought as well.
3 gravediggers out of 5
